Kentillä
Kentillä is a Finnish noun form meaning “on the fields.” It is the inessive plural form of kenttä, a word whose core sense is field, court, or playing surface. The basic sense of kenttä covers literal fields in agriculture or open spaces as well as surfaces used for a particular activity, such as sports or gatherings. In everyday language, kenttä appears in many compound terms, for example urheilukenttä (sports field), jääkenttä (ice rink), and tiedekenttä (field of science). The plural form kentillä is used to indicate location on multiple fields: on the fields.
